Description
Entangled gives you the materials needed to bind two blocks together, allowing you to interact with either one as if they were the same block! This will allow you to transfer items, energy, fluids or whatever you want instantly, you can have more than six sides to work with or you could just hide your messy cables, the possibilities are endless!

Step-by-step Guide:
Binding an Entangled Block
1. Craft an Entangled Block and an Entangled Binder
2. Place down your Entangled Block
3. Right-Click on the block you want to bind with the Entangled Binder
4. Right-Click on your Entangled Block with the Entangled Binder

Unbinding an Entangled Block
1. Select an empty slot on your hotbar
2. Start crouching
3. Right-Click on the Entangled Block

Configuration
Config options:
- allowDimensional: true or false, true by default
Determines whether entangled blocks can be bound between different dimensions. - maxDistance: -1 or a number greater than 0, -1 by default
Determines the maximum distance between an entangled and its target. -1 means no limit. - renderBlockHighlight: true or false, true by default
A client-side option to determine whether when looking at an entangled block, its targeted block is highlighted. - rotateRenderedBlock: true or false, true by default
A client-side option to determine whether the block rendered inside an entangled block spins around.
Tags:
- entangled:invalid_targets block tag
The entangled block cannot target any blocks inside the tag. - entangled:render_blacklist block tag
Any blocks in the tag will not be rendered inside entangled blocks. - entangled:render_blacklist block entity type tag
The entangled block won't render any block entity for which their type is in the tag.

FAQ
Does the Entangled Block work interdimensionally?
Yes, just select a block in a different dimension with the Entangled Binder
